WATCH: Marizanne Kapp cleans up Hayley Matthews with an unplayable delivery in DC vs MI 2025 WPL Final
In a much-awaited clash at the Brabourne Stadium in Mumbai, Marizanne Kapp delivered a stunning performance that gave Delhi Capitals (DC) a breakthrough in the Women’s Premier League (WPL) 2025 final against Mumbai Indians (MI). Known for her fierce competitiveness and all-round capabilities, Kapp showcased her bowling prowess by cleaning up star all-rounder Hayley Matthews with an unplayable delivery.
As the match unfolded, Kapp opened the bowling for Delhi Capitals, who were seeking their first WPL title after finishing as runners-up in the previous two seasons. The atmosphere was electric, with fans eagerly anticipating a clash between two formidable teams: the Capitals, led by Meg Lanning, and the defending champions, Mumbai Indians, captained by Harmanpreet Kaur.
Kapp’s moment of brilliance came during the third over of the innings. After a cautious start from Matthews, who had been in exceptional form throughout the tournament, Kapp bowled a delivery that pitched on a good length and swung late, leaving Matthews no chance. The ball crashed into leg stump off the inside edge, sending shockwaves through the Mumbai camp as they lost their first wicket for just 5 runs.

This wicket was crucial, as Matthews had been a key player for MI, contributing significantly with the bat in the last couple of games. But in the finalshe got out after scoring only 3 runs off 10 balls.
